Personally, I think when new players join it can be a bit overwhelming with no clear direction on how to actually get started with roleplaying. It's not like the other servers in the DarkRP category, requiring a much different type of play style from what they might be used to. Maybe a tutorial of sort, guiding them to certain aspects of the server - I know for a fact a lot of new players I talk to immediately want to go Police, however are stuck behind the 4 hour playtime barrier (which I don't disagree with). Often I find them just standing around waiting the time out (if they haven't already got themselves banned) as there's no obvious direction on what else they could be doing with their time

Maybe it could be looked into for having an interactive tutorial for new players, directing them to chopping some wood, doing some mining, maybe a tour of the map with an explanation of what each area entails (I.E. Lake: this is where you can fish to gain food to consume and/or sell | Corleone: an area run by the mafia, useful for conducting underground activities | etc) through either a cutscene or by giving them a trabant and some directions, when they hit a certain waypoint it gives them a short explanation or even then a cutscene. Although RP Assistants play a huge role is supporting players, I don't think it should be solely down to them as they may still want to have their own time to RP, but equally all new players should be offered support to get them started to find the fun in LimeLight like we all did

Another option could be to update the F1/F4 menu to include an in-game guides section, offering easy to follow tutorials on game aspects, what the requirements are for completing the task and what benefits could follow. Naturally this wouldn't include everything as it's important they retain the urge to find out in-character (I.E. Meth recipes). It could be based from simple PNG's, or linking to the guides section within the forums (doing it this way might be a good opportunity to show them the forums exist, and the wealth of knowledge that can be found here not just through the guides section). I myself would happily write up some of these guides to support new players finding their feet
